Body: The Fight within MMA
In MMA, you’ll experience a plethora of fighting techniques from various disciplines such as boxing, kickboxing,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, Muay Thai, and wrestling. These techniques, combined with relentless training and perseverance, will transform both your body and your mindset. It’s not just about fighting; it’s about pushing past your limits, setting and achieving goals, and constantly evolving as an individual.
